diff options
Diffstat (limited to 'src/interfaces/ecpg/test/sql/show.pgc')
-rw-r--r-- | src/interfaces/ecpg/test/sql/show.pgc |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/interfaces/ecpg/test/sql/show.pgc b/src/interfaces/ecpg/test/sql/show.pgc index 8eb71a7262a..d3a888d5095 100644 --- a/src/interfaces/ecpg/test/sql/show.pgc +++ b/src/interfaces/ecpg/test/sql/show.pgc @@ -6,7 +6,7 @@ EXEC SQL INCLUDE ../regression; int main(int argc, char* argv[]) { EXEC SQL BEGIN DECLARE SECTION; - char var[25]; + char var[25] = "public"; EXEC SQL END DECLARE SECTION; ECPGdebug(1, stderr); @@ -15,6 +15,10 @@ int main(int argc, char* argv[]) { EXEC SQL WHENEVER SQLWARNING SQLPRINT; EXEC SQL WHENEVER SQLERROR SQLPRINT; + EXEC SQL SET search_path TO :var; + EXEC SQL SHOW search_path INTO :var; + printf("Var: Search path: %s\n", var); + EXEC SQL SET search_path TO 'public'; EXEC SQL SHOW search_path INTO :var; printf("Var: Search path: %s\n", var); |